Abstract: Diapirs in the Southwestern Gulf of Mexico
John Ewing
ABSTRACT
Recent surveys have traced the belt of diapiric structures, first observed in the Sigs-bee deep, through the Bay of Campeche to within about 60 miles of the saline basin of southeastern mexico. This prompts a further examination of the structure of the Gulf of Mexico with particular attention to the possibilities that the diapirs are salt.
